§ 6830 — Unlawful for operators of OHVs to disobey command to stop

Text
It shall be unlawful for any operator of an OHV to wilfully disobey a signal to bring such OHV to a stop when such signal is given by hand, voice, emergency lights, siren or other visual or audible signal by a uniformed police, peace or environmental protection officer acting in the lawful performance of duty. A violation of this section shall be an unclassified misdemeanor with the penalties set forth in § 6831 of this title.

Legislative History
61 Del. Laws, c. 142, § 6 ; 70 Del. Laws, c. 186, § 1 ; 77 Del. Laws, c. 60, § 18
